How the Law and Order System in Toronto Actually Functions
Toronto operates under a publicly funded policing model led by the Toronto Police Service, known for community engagement strategies and a focus on de-escalation techniques. The system relies on clear legal frameworks derived from federal and provincial laws, including the Criminal Code of Canada, with oversight from civilian review boards and municipal authorities. Unlike some larger US cities with specialized tactical units, Toronto emphasizes prevention, mental health support, and neighborhood policing. This structure aims to build trust through consistent presence, dialogue, and data-driven responses to crime, reflecting a model increasingly discussed in U.S. reform circles.
